M. Lewitowicz
About
M. Lewitowicz has authored 85 papers that have received a total of 1.9k indexed citations.
This includes 74 papers in Nuclear and High Energy Physics, 61 papers in Radiation and 25 papers in Atomic and Molecular Physics, and Optics. The topics of these papers are Nuclear physics research studies (71 papers), Nuclear Physics and Applications (61 papers) and Atomic and Molecular Physics (22 papers). M. Lewitowicz is often cited by papers focused on Nuclear physics research studies (71 papers), Nuclear Physics and Applications (61 papers) and Atomic and Molecular Physics (22 papers) and collaborates with scholars based in France, Poland and Germany. M. Lewitowicz's co-authors include D. Guillemaud-Mueller, R. Anne, Yu. É. Penionzhkevich, C. Borcea and F. de Oliveira Santos and has published in prestigious journals such as Physical Review Letters, Physics Letters B and Nuclear Physics A.
